London : James Nisbet & Co., 1880. First edition. Ballantyne's fictionalised take on the Bligh Mutiny, Fletcher Christian, Pitcairn, and subsequent events. "He assures the readers that the merest spider-web of fiction has been employed to bind the facts together. In such a work he excels, and he has never done one better than this" (The Scotsman, 2nd November 1880). Crown 8vo (20cm). (viii),(414),[ii],(16)pp. Frontispiece, extra pictorial title, and four plates. Original blue pictorial cloth gilt over bevelled boards; some minor rubbing and wear; endpapers slightly cracked; a little shaken; a few edge spots, but overall still a good copy. Gift inscription dated 1883 to William Lawrence from Howard Gilliat (1848-1906).
